The Hearth Country Ash-Vac is brought to you from the same manufacturer that makes the industry leading tri-motor professional chimney sweep vacuum. The Hearth Country Ash-Vac is made with the quality, detail and features you expect from a leading manufacturer. The Hearth Country Ash Vacuum is a Last Stage cleaner. It should be used to remove the ash dust left over after the fireplace has been cleared with a shovel. The built- in shake off filter clears any ash build up without removing the lid. To operate the filter: turn off the vacuum; shake the agitator tube to release the build-up and then turn the vacuum back on to continue cleaning. Home based ash-vacs should not be used to pick up hot/warm embers. Even though the Hearth Country Ash-Vac does have multiple design features to minimize embers from damaging the unit, use the Hearth Country Ash-Vac to pick up cold ash only. The hose is made of a light-weight metal alloy, the pre-filter is a fine metal mesh that protects the inner hepa filter. The bottom of the canister has a dual-wall sub floor keeping the outer canister cool. Ash enters the vacuum through the top of the unit minimizing the effect previously removed ash has on the suction power of the unit. Also, unique to the Hearth Country Ash-Vac is a center weighted comfortable hand grip and specially insulated 80db quiet motor. I purchased this wood stove about 3 years ago. I have owned other stoves in the past and was very pleased with each one...until I bought this one.
I live in New England and here we need to depend on a good reliable source of heat.I had not seen this stove prior to purchasing it...mistake #1. None were on display anywhere in my area. I went on the recommendation of a friend who had one, but knew nothing about wood stoves....mistake #2.First off, the stove is very hard to regulate. It either is set low and smokes all over or all the way open and will blast you out of the house. It probably would work better in a large home for that reason.
It is a poorly built cheap quality most likely a Chinese made stove(as quoted on another website). The first year I had to replace the door gasket 3 times until I emailed the company and they sent one that has worked fine since. The door is out of alignment and doesn't fit flush. The hinges have a lot of slop in them. Year 2, the handle broke off, very poor design and materials.I emailed and complained about it and they did send a new one free. Year 3, Some of the fire brick are now breaking and the grate has broken.There is a big hole in the middle. A new one on their website costs $[...] + shipping. They are also to last for years according to their website.
This is not an air tight wood stove like I thought. There are gaps in the doors and The fire box is thin metal. Overall it does technically work, but for the money it is very, very poor. Please do yourself a favor and look to a different company.

The Vogelzang Heartwood Wood-Burning Heater is a handsome, high-performance cabinet wood stove that efficiently circulates heat within your home. A bimetal thermostat controls combustion for constant-level heat radiation. Firebrick-lined firebox with cast iron grate accepts 23in. logs. One load burns up to 5 hours. Lift top reveals two burners for fry pan or tea kettle.Features include a large gasketed cast iron 13in. x 11in. feed-door, gasketed cast iron ash-door with spin draft and a large ash tray for easy ash removal. Uses 6in. flue. Safety tested to UL 1482. Optional blower Item# 173605 sold separately.

The blades move faster the higher the stove temp. A wood burning stove is best for this fan as the heavily insulated pellet stoves don't have enough surface heat to get the fan spinning decently. I have an Englander wood stove and run it at around 400-550 degrees and this fan pushes enough air that it will flutter a dangling piece of paper from 10ft away. It is also silent and I do mean silent (very nice) whereas those bolt-on accessory fans made for wood stoves that plug into the wall outlet sound like a hairdryer on terminal overload.
The fan generates electricity and runs from the temp differential between the stove surface and the heat sinks at the top (some kind of piezzo electric thing or some such). If you fire up the stove too hot (over 600 degrees) there's a metal flat spring on the bottom of the fan base that tips up the front a fraction of an inch to keep the fan from getting too hot and damaging it. As the stove cools back down below 600deg the spring straightens back out and the fan sits flat on the stove surface again.

The following applies to glass doors that have a fair amount of soot on them. Lately I have not been able to buy Rutland 84 Hearth and Glass cleaner in my area, it is a creamy consistency cleaner designed to take the soot off of glass doors with a little scrubbing. I've tried everything else available in our area including Rutland spray bottle (a liquid, not the same product as the 84 which is a cream) and four other brands that say they are fireplace glass door cleaners. I've tried white vinegar and wood ashes on a paper towel, which by the way works better than the other products but not as good as Rutland 84. Rutland 84 takes a few minutes to completely clean doors, the vinegar/ashes takes 10-15 minutes and you should take the doors off and lay horizontal (a pain!) and I don't think the vinegar is good for the door seal gasket. The other brands, including glass top stove cleaner, take a half hour of scrubbing and still leave a lot of soot on the door, they suck. I've had several types of fireplace inserts including my current Blaze King Princess, which is wonderful, but they all soot the glass after a week or so, without Rutland 84 I would not want to make a fire!!

If you're using a woodstove, you need to know what's going on inside your chimney. If you're burning too cold, you could be coating your chimney with creosote, sending massive amounts of particulate matter into the atmosphere, and losing quite a bit of heat from your wood.If you're burning too hot, you could be wasting energy, damaging your catalytic combustor or even chancing a chimney fire. It's important that you know exactly what's happening, so you can burn efficiently, stay comfortable, and most importantly, stay SAFE.Condar patented surface thermometers are bimetal instruments that attach magnetically to your stove or flue pipe. They indicate the surface temperature, and by extension the temperature of the flue gasses. They're instrumental in fine tuning your burning habits for maximum safety and efficiency.The ChimGard 3-4 Thermometer is the most popular surface thermometer for use on single-walled stove pipe. Colored "zones" on the enamelled steel face indicate safe burning temperatures, letting you know what's going on. A cool-touch metal bail allows you to move the magnetic thermometer wherever you wish on the pipe, or you may use the safety screw (included) to insure the thermometer stays exactly where you want it, with no chance of slipping off the pipe.

It works. Very efficient use of the heat coming off of the wood-burning stove. You might find where some people state that it doesn't work, that it hardly spins or that it can't even move a piece of paper that you might place in front of it when checking airflow. To those reviews, I state that they did not perform proper placement as placement is the key. My wood-burning stove is an insert to my fireplace and I have my fan located on one of the sides, a few inches from the front and angled a few degrees to the center. The fan takes advantage of temperature differentials, meaning that it needs cooler air as well as hot. Thus, place the fan on the side and not dead center. My particular fan starts spinning (albeit slowly) when the stove's at a surface temp of about 100 degrees F. Spins faster as the stove temp increases. It's very quiet and is designed to move air in a wide dispersion (vs. a more narrow field, like you might get with a high-speed, 120V fan). I like it.
